Study On Treatment Of Wastewater Containing NH4+-N And Cu2+ In Copper Mining Area

In the copper mining area,A large amount of heavy metal Waste-water was produced during the copper mining process.At same time the large amount of ammonia-nitrogen wastewater was generated in the residents'lives and farmers'fertilization process around the mining area.These two types waste-water are mixed leachate into the underground around the mining area to form the copper mining sewage which contain Cu2+,NH4+-N.Aiming at this kind of sewage,it is treated by combining the adsorption method and the biological aerated filter method which contain low concentration Cu2+,NH4+-N.Preparation copper slag-based ceramsite with copper smelting waste slag which produce from the smelting process.Using the prepared porous ceramsite to remove Cu2+of the sewage,After adsorption the liquid enters the BAF process to further remove NH4+-N in the sewage.Research on the optimized preparation conditions of copper slag-based ceramsite.and explored the adsorption and removal rule of Cu2+with modified copper slag-based ceramsite.Under different operation,the removal of BAF on NH4+-N after adsorption and decopperization was studied.The results shows:?1?Under the conditions of copper slag:sodium bicarbonate:pore forming agent?mass ratio?=10:1:1,calcining temperature being 1050°C,holding time 30 minutes,a ceramsite was prepared with optimized performances which meet the requirements of the national standard.The performance index which contain mud content=0.161%,hydrochloric acid solubility=0.195%,bulk density=0.561 g/ml,compressive strength130200 N,porosity=53.61%.?2?The optimal conditions for the removal of Cu2+from sewage by modified copper slag based ceramsite are:the initial concentration is 50mg/L,the initial pH is 5,the adsorption temperature is 35?,the adsorption is 1 g.Under these conditions,the adsorption reaches equilibrium at 90 min,and the adsorption capacity is 0.936 mg/g,the adsorption process of Cu2+with modified porous ceramsite satisfies the pseudo second order kinetic equation,Langmuir isotherm adsorption model.The adsorption of modified ceramsite is monolayer adsorption.?3?When the initial concentration of Cu2+,NH4+-N is 20mg/L,100mg/L,respectively.Under the optimize condition the removal rate of Cu2+can reach 85%after270 min adsorption by modified ceramsite.It can meet the requirements of discharge standard,the concentration of NH4+-N in the adsorbed solution is 95.27mg/L,which needs further treatment by BAF process.?4?For BAF process composite hanging film method was adopted,under the condition that the ration of sewage inflow and activated sludge is 4:1 and the aeration rate is 1.2 L/min.BAF membrane hanging was successful.Acco rding to the single factor test,the optimal process parameters of BAF are HRT=6 h,C/N ratio is 4:1,pH of influent water is 8,Under this condition,BAF c an remove NH4+-N and TN in simulated sewage,the removal rates are 96%a nd 65%respectively,and the NH4+-N in the effluent water meets the discharge standard.
